Our favorite dishes are the Wasabi Prawn ($15), Volcano Pop Chicken ($23) and Staff Meal ($21). Also the Sausage Fried Rice ($20) is a winner. Honey Beef was average and Sweet and Sour Chicken as expected.
Gets very loud as mentioned in other reviews so arrive early as it is small space with many seats so it gets crowded. We arrived at 5:00 PM and it was good however by 6:30 PM it was hard to hear others talk.
BYO fee is $3 for each glass. Import Japanese beers are $9.
Service was attentive and timely.

Bookings essential as the place was hopping at 8pm on a Thursday night.
Taiwanese sausage was as authentic as it gets with the taste but the size was a little small for its price.
Their signature dish was definitely the Ma Ma Custard Fried Chicken. Just the right amount of batter for crunch and paired nicely with sweet chilli mayo.
Mince Mince was a different take on the traditional braised mince rice. Flavours were a bit bland and I much prefer traditional Taiwanese versions.
Service was super quick and attentive. We were seated, ordered, and the dishes came within 15 minutes.
Great for: fried chicken, sausage, and a cold beer

South Melbourne
South Melbourne hosts the city’s oldest continuous market, founded in 1867. Rows of neatly arranged fruit, vegetables and flowers splash yellows, greens and reds along the entire perimeter, where the whole neighbourhood gathers for Saturday feasts. Inside the hall, shoppers hover over the mouth-watering displays of delicatessens and specialty food shops. Further in, a bazaar full of giftware, clothing, and kitchen utensils completes the scene. Take a break to walk the wide and shady streets and stroll along the Victorian-era heritage terrace houses. But return to the market in time for some paella, simmering in three large frypans on the footpath and served straight onto your plate.
